Remember When Porsche Race Cars Had An Engine In The Front?
Porsche was ready to kill off the 911 in the middle of the 1980s with an eye toward replacing it with the heavier and faster 928 grand tourer. Porsche couldn’t just let the 911 die on the vine and not replace it in the world of motorsport, so the company was looking to promote its entry-level 944 model to represent the Stuttgart crest on the race track. Rivian Is Opening Its Charging Network to Other EVs
Up until now, Rivian has done that exclusively for its customers with proprietary chargers and even lounge areas complete with coffee, snacks, and adventure vibes at certain locations. The electric automaker is expanding that network with a Charging Outpost near Joshua Tree National Park, and more importantly, it’s the first Rivian charging spot that’s open to all compatible EVs. CCS plug connectors are standard and, yes, there’s support for EVs with automaker-approved North American Charging Standard adapters.

New Popemobile Is An Electric Mercedes-Benz G-Wagen, Just Like God Intended
The Pope has had a lot of cool and sometimes weird rides over the years, with Popemobiles ranging from Fiat Pandas and Mercedes-Benz MLs to Kia Souls and Jeep Wranglers. Probably the best and most iconic Popemobiles are based on the Mercedes-Benz G-Class, first a W460-series 230G in the 1980s and then a later W463 G500 starting in 2002. Now the Pope is getting a new car, and it’s based on the fully electric Mercedes G580.
